Mon 01 Dec 2003 02:44:25 AM UTC, original submission:  

Not really a bug, but I just wanted to suggest that as more non-technical users begin using gnome, it would be important to help these users decide whether it is appropriate to trust a given application that requests root access via GKSu.  How would a user know that redhat-config-network is a "safe" program and redhot-config-network is a trojan? 

My suggestion is that GKSu have backend that would allow it to query the package database for the program attempting to gain root access and display some useful information.  For example, a root password prompt might display:

I need the root password to run "redhat-config-network".
This program is listed in the system database.
It's permissions and file sizes match the database.

OR

I need the root password to run "redhot-config-network".
This program is not listed in the system database.
No file permission or size information is available.
If you did not request this program to run, it is recommended that you proceed with extreme caution.

Hope this idea is helpful or spawn an even better idea. :-)
